ホームページ > バックエンド開発 > PHPチュートリアル > 文字化けに関する問題の解決を専門家に手伝ってもらえますか?

文字化けに関する問題の解決を専門家に手伝ってもらえますか?

WBOY
リリース: 2016-06-13 13:40:15
オリジナル
966 人が閲覧しました

文字化けしたコードの問題を解決できるのは誰ですか? 。 。 。 。
私のphpファイルはgbkですが、htmlに書き込まれたファイルのメッセージヘッダーのエンコードがutf-8なのですが、読み出すと文字化けしてしまいます。エンコードの問題について教えていただけませんか。 。 。頭痛! ! !

-----解決策--------------------------------
データベースのエンコーディングを確認してください。コーディングを統一するのが最善です。
------解決策---------
PHP ファイルを UTF-8 に変更します。データベース内の数値以外のフィールドには UTF-8 を使用します。
------解決策---------
ヘッダーのエンコーディングは utf-8 で、次に phpプログラムは UTF-8 でエンコードされたデータを出力する必要があります
出力内容に静的な中国語文字 (プログラムに直接書き込まれたもの) が含まれていない限り、プログラム ファイルを保存するためにどのようなエンコードが使用されても、さまざまな共通言語で問題ありません。エンコーディング 基本的な ASCII 文字は同じです
ダイナミック テキストが utf-8 でエンコードされていない場合は、エンコーディングの変換が必要です
たとえば、mysql からデータを読み取る前に、
mysql_query('set names utf8');

------解決策---------

話し合う
私のphpファイルはgbkですが、htmlに書き込まれたファイルのメッセージヘッダーのエンコードがutf-8なのですが、読み出すと文字化けしてしまいます エンコードの問題についてどなたか教えていただけませんか? 。 。頭痛! ! !
関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ート